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						522041ee7b
					 | 
					
						
						
							
							regularize options which control size/speed trade
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com> 
						
						
					 | 
					
						2011-09-10 13:25:57 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						fb132e4737
					 | 
					
						
						
							
							whitespace cleanup
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<dvlasenk@redhat.com> 
						
						
					 | 
					
						2010-10-29 11:46:52 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						03a5fe378e
					 | 
					
						
						
							
							sha1: small tweak for clearer code, no logic changes
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com> 
						
						
					 | 
					
						2010-10-24 20:51:28 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						f4c93ab304
					 | 
					
						
						
							
							sha1: use Rob's code, it's smaller and faster
						
						
						
						
						
						
						
						function                                             old     new   delta
static.rconsts                                         -      16     +16
sha1_process_block64                                 460     298    -162
------------------------------------------------------------------------------
(add/remove: 1/0 grow/shrink: 0/1 up/down: 16/-162)          Total: -146 bytes
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com> 
						
						
					 | 
					
						2010-10-24 19:27:30 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						7ab94ca351
					 | 
					
						
						
							
							md5: remove outdated comment
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com> 
						
						
					 | 
					
						2010-10-19 02:33:39 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						302ad1450e
					 | 
					
						
						
							
							libbb/hash_md5_sha: use common ctx and code for md5 and sha1/256
						
						
						
						
						
						
						
						function                                             old     new   delta
sha256_process_block64                               421     433     +12
md5_crypt                                            578     587      +9
md5_begin                                             43      50      +7
md5_hash                                              99      97      -2
sha1_end                                              85      82      -3
md5_end                                               36      31      -5
common64_end                                          93      86      -7
sha1_hash                                             97       -     -97
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com> 
						
						
					 | 
					
						2010-10-19 02:16:12 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						c48a5c607d
					 | 
					
						
						
							
							hash_md5_sha: use common finalization routine for MD5 and sha1/256. -15 bytes
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<dvlasenk@redhat.com> 
						
						
					 | 
					
						2010-10-18 14:48:30 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 | 
				
			
				
					
						
							
							
								 
								Denys Vlasenko
							
						 
					 | 
					
						
						
							
						
						b5aa1d95a1
					 | 
					
						
						
							
							libbb/hash_sha.c -> libbb/hash_md5_sha.c
						
						
						
						
						
						
						
						Signed-off-by: Denys Vlasenko <dvlasenk@redhat.com> 
						
						
					 | 
					
						2010-10-18 13:47:47 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
							
							
						
					 |